No previous experience of canal boating is necessary but you must be physically fit and reasonably agile and strong. Once registered as a potential trainee, you will be offered a 'taster' trip on one of their trips where you can shadow the crew and see what is involved.

On each trip the skipper is accompanied by two, or in some cases three trained crew members and on your taster trip you will be able to see how the crew work together.

The next step is to complete a 2 part training schedule involving a mix of teaching and hands on practice. Participating in the training programme is required for experienced canal boaters as well as novices.
